About the role

Ponsse is one of the world’s largest manufacturers of cut-to-length forest machines. We are focusing on succeeding with our customers and oriented to people. We want to be the preferred partner for responsible forestry and to reach that we combine great people working together with high tech machinery and cutting-edge digital technologies.

 

Summary/Objective 
Under limited supervision, the service technician - mechanic position performs work of considerable difficulty in the repair and maintenance of logging machines - specifically Harvester Heads - at the customers job sites; performs related work as assigned. 


Essential Functions
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

  • Installation of loose heads onto logging machines 
  • Performs troubleshooting, inspections and preventive maintenance of installed heads. 
  • Prepares and maintains records and reports for billing purposes.

Work Environment
While performing the duties of this job, the employee is frequently exposed to fumes or airborne particles, moving mechanical parts and vibration. The employee is frequently exposed to the outdoor weather elements. The employee is occasionally exposed to a variety of extreme conditions. The noise level in the work environment can be loud. 


Physical Demands
The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by an employee to successfully perform the essential functions of this job.
While performing the duties of this job, the employee is regularly required to talk and hear. This position is very active and requires standing, walking, bending, kneeling, stooping, crouching, crawling, and climbing all day. The employee must frequently lift and/or move items over 50 pounds. Specific vision abilities required by this job include close vision, distance vision, color vision, peripheral vision, depth perception and ability to adjust focus. 


Position Type/Expected Hours of Work
This is a full-time position, and hours of work and days are Monday through Friday, 7a.m. to 5p.m. 


Travel
Regular travel is expected for this position to and from customer work sites.


Required Education and Experience
Two-year degree in heavy equipment technician program or three years of experience and/or training in heavy equipment repair and maintenance shop or any combination of education, training and experience that demonstrates the ability to perform the duties of the position.
